Summary

Today, we are joined by Simon Judes, Co-CIO at Winton for a conversation on how they use quantitative investment strategies and statistical research to generate alpha. We discuss how the characterization of Crisis Alpha has the potential to be misleading and why the speed of your trading should be determined by your objective, their process of discovering new ideas through research and the pitfalls of relying too heavily on automation. We also discuss how they stay diversified through alternative market selection, why it is important to look beyond volatility when assessing risk and much more.
